INPUT AND OUTPUTS 

 

 

 

 

Relay  Outputs: 

Panel  has  2  pcs.  30V  DC,  2A  dry  contact  relay  outputs  which  are  fire  relay  (normally  without 

power) and trouble relay (normally with power). 
 

Important  Note: 

The  relays  on  the  board  are  small  current  signal  relays.  If  need  to  command  higher  voltage  or 

current devices, please use the appropriate devices such as contactor. Otherwise panel may be damaged which is 
out off-treaty of guarantee. 
 

Siren Outputs : 

There is

 

2 pcs 24 V DC 500 mA with automatic fuse protected. Overloading the output will cause 

fault on panel. The siren output is monitored with end of line resistor, in order to detect short circuits and trouble of 
breaking  lines.  Cable  of  the  siren  power  line  should  be 

2x1.5  mm²  and  connection  should  be  done  as  indicated 

below.      
 

 

 

Alarm Relay   : 

While pressing on 

“Alarm Cancel/Alarm” button or when receiving fire alarm from detectors, it will 

change contact and get active position in order to use any other systems by remote control. In order to return to its 
initial position of active relay, fire c

ondition must be ended and press on “Reset” button onto the panel

 

Trouble Relay : 

It changes contact and get active position during trouble warning and without power panel. Trouble 

Relay returns to its initial position automatically as soon as trouble condition ends. 

Power  Output  (AUX)  : 

There  is  1  pc. 

24VDC 500mA’lik mA power output  with automatic fuse. In case of mains 

failure, power output will be supplied till battery ends

 

Power Input : 

The system is designed to operate with 195~250 V AC 50 Hz Earth connections must be made from 

earth  connector  and  earth  resistor  must  be  less  than  10ohm.  The  mains  supply  of  the  panel  must  be  via  an 
independent automatic fuse rated 230 V AC 6A. This fuse must be separate from the other fuses and a caution note 
should be w

ritten such as “ATTENTION! FIRE ALARM CONTROL PANEL’S FUSE. DO NOT CLOSE DOWN”. 

Recommended  cable  types  for  mains  power  supply  are  3x2.5  NYM  or  3x2.5  NYA.  Do  not  connect  or  disconnect 
conventional  area  lines,  supply  lines,  PCB  connections  while  the  panel  is  energized.  Do  not  contact  with  system 
while the panel is energized. 
 
 

WARNING! 

Do not use the device without earth connection.
